Exco Technologies Limited (EXCOF) has announced a third-quarter earnings release scheduled for July 29, 2026. This is a standard corporate disclosure announcement with limited immediate market implications. The company, a tier-one automotive and industrial parts supplier, typically uses such announcements to signal transparency and maintain investor relations protocols.

The timing and structure of this announcement suggests routine quarterly reporting rather than any material business development. Absent pre-release guidance or commentary hinting at operational disruptions, surprises, or strategic shifts, the market reaction is likely to remain contained to post-earnings volatility once results are published.

For industrial-focused investors, EXCOF's Q3 performance will be material data points on automotive production trends, supply chain stability, and margin sustainability in a period of ongoing economic uncertainty. Automotive supplier earnings have become bellwethers for manufacturing health and consumer demand signals.
